Social Worker of the Year Katie Eppenhof Is Donating Prize Money to Young People Who Want to Use Their Own Strengths.

Summary by tilburg.com
Katie Eppenhof, youth worker at R-Newt and Social Worker of the Year since June 2024, donated her €3,000 prize money this month to a new youth network focused on strengthening lived experience among young people. The donation was made on behalf of Sociaal Werk werkt!, the organization behind the annual award that raises awareness of the value of the social work profession.
